Window Handles Replacement

doorpanels-300x200.jpgIf you are looking to replace your uPVC window handles, it is important that you follow the correct procedure and ensure that your new handle matches the lock you have already installed. This is not just to protect yourself but also for insurance purposes.

The choice of the perfect window handles can make or break the look of a room. Handles are available in many different styles and materials.

Material

Window handles are a crucial part of any single or double glazed window. They come in a variety of styles to complement your home. There are many locking mechanisms that will ensure security and prevent children opening the windows accidentally. A window handle that is lockable is especially useful for homes with children as it creates an easy way to prevent them from opening the window.

To replace the uPVC handle on your window, remove the screw cap and unscrew the handle with the correct tool. This process could be a bit difficult, and it is important to avoid damaging the handle or the frame. Once the handle is removed, you can replace it with a brand new one, ensuring that it is secure and fits the design of your window.

When choosing a new window handle, you should consider the material used and the size of the spindle. The spindle is a peg that is square that extends from the base handle. It is crucial to measure the length of the handle to ensure that the replacement fits properly. This can be done by pressing a small object like a needle into the base handle to determine the depth of the square pin. Once you have this number, you can select an alternative window replacement companies that matches your window.

There are a variety of uPVC handles. Some are specifically designed for the window type they are fitted on. For instance Espag handles can be found on tilt and turn windows, while Cockspur handles are usually found on uPVC casement or awning windows. Other types of uPVC windows handles include monkey tail handles as well as blade or spade handles.

It is important to consider the step height when selecting the handle. This is the distance that runs from the base of the handle to the frame where it is placed. This will help you choose a handle that will fit your window perfectly and be easy to open and close. You can find this information on the manufacturer's website or by looking at pictures of the handle.

Mechanism for locking

This part of the handle connects to a multi-point locking mechanism that is positioned to the window. This makes it more difficult for burglars to break into your home, and is an effective deterrent because they are less likely to move the handle and lock to secure it.

You may not have to remove the entire window frame if are able to replace both the handle and lock. This is contingent on the kind of mechanism your windows use. If your uPVC window is fitted with a espagnolette lock, then any DIYer can easily replace the handle and handle, while still using the multipoint locking system.

There are a number of different types of espagnolette locks, each with their own particular mechanisms that allow them to function. The most well-known type of espagnolette lock is called the espag handle. It has a square spindle on the back, which slides into the receivers shaped like mushrooms on the window frame as the handle rotates.

Another type of handle is the casement latch which works a bit like a door chain lock. They are typically mounted at the top of the frame or sash of the window and secure two parts to stop them from opening too large. They are also fairly easy to replace, however it is crucial to make sure that you receive a correct replacement for your handle and window latch.

The window pin lock is the final kind of latch. It is fixed to the sash, and works by preventing sash movement. This type of lock may not be as secure as a casement latch but it offers adequate security. It's also an easy replacement for your broken handle.

When choosing a new lock and Window Handles Replacement handle for your uPVC windows it is crucial to determine the length of the spindle. This will help you find an alternative that fits your window precisely. Think about whether you would prefer an open-ended handle that is cranked only one way or a handle inline that can be operated either way.

Installation

Over time, your window handles may begin to exhibit signs of wear and tear that will require a replacement. This can be obvious, such as when the handle falls off or becomes stiffer to turn, or more subtle such as when you notice that it won't lock as easily. Regardless of how you recognise the need, it's essential to replace your window handle as soon as you can to ensure safety and security at home.

Check that the handle will fit your windows prior to purchasing it. It is especially important to check the dimensions of a uPVC handle before replacing it. Different types of handles may have slightly different measurements, which could cause your handle not to function or appear to be right in your window. Consider whether the handle is designed for a casement window or an awning window. Each type has its own distinct style.

Once you've determined the type of window handle you'll need, you'll be able to begin the process of installing it. First, you'll need to remove your old handle from the window. To do this you will need to remove the screw from the handle's base. You will then need to remove screw cap from the handle. Then, you will have to attach the new handle with a pin or screw.

Depending on the type of handle you've got it is important to determine whether you want an right or left-handed model. Inline handles are universal and don't have to be the same hand as the existing one, but older uPVC handles that require handling will have a set step height (the distance between the apex of the handle to the frame or base) and you'll have to make sure that the new handle is the same height for step.

After you have put the new window handle in You'll have to test it in order to make sure that it's working correctly. This is done by turning the handle to activate the locking mechanism and then ensuring whether it's locked securely. If it's locked, you're now ready to take advantage of your new window handle!
